#934256 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#934256 is composed of 57.6% red, 25.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.1% magenta, 41.5%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 345.2 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 41.8%. #934256 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ff84ac with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#934256 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#934256 has RGB values of R:147, G:66,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.41,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9650774.

Shades and Tints of #934256
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0507 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.
